Transaction 6a504f6270e38d0a5f95b53694ffcec57dd13494692917d677c68cbc7dc1a1e0

18 Input
2 Outputs
  • 6a504f6270e38d0a5f95b53694ffcec57dd13494692917d677c68cbc7dc1a1e0:0
  • value  22598603
    address  35FQqqwtWXxDjSh3onSSAkJ82bjG7VUoKn
  • 6a504f6270e38d0a5f95b53694ffcec57dd13494692917d677c68cbc7dc1a1e0:1
  • value  268647
    address  3CC8URa4qzNBLaPmy1iFivvCbbBARLY2go